3-Hydroxytyramine Hydrochloride

CAS No.:62-31-7 | Common Name:Dopamine Hydrochloride
Molecular Formula:C8H12ClNO2
Molecular Weight:189.45

Physical and Chemical Properties

  • Appearance: White crystalline powder
  • Melting Point: 248~250°C (decompose)
  • Solubility: Freely soluble in water, slightly soluble in ethanol, insoluble in ether
  • Stability: Easy to oxidize and change color when exposed to light and air

Applications

  1. Pharmaceutical API: Vasoactive drug for clinical treatment of cardiogenic shock, hypotension and congestive heart failure.
  2. Biochemical reagent: Raw material for neuroscience experiment and pharmacological research.
  3. Fine chemical intermediate for catecholamine related derivative synthesis.

Storage Condition

Seal tightly, store at 2–8°C in cool, dry and dark warehouse, avoid light and air contact.
